Transaction 56bfea03f21f7a76d62cd35320502907725ae551c09613aca7d2dd7c2ec5780c
1 Input
1 Output
-
56bfea03f21f7a76d62cd35320502907725ae551c09613aca7d2dd7c2ec5780c:0
- value
- 8695895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 342fe98a9df3f58cdcf3169472a078fb03ee9465 OP_EQUAL
- address
- MCf6mQdvxZA16qdxrk6jRohDEdaBeJhgAx